Timeline - Unit G324

2
Timeline Order of events Verbal/non-verbal/ technical codes Screen fades from black to (Girl 1) walking down road looking vulnerable (Girl 1) walks past alley where there are two men looking suspicious (Boy 1) hands (boy 2) a small package which he puts in his pocket (Girl 1) is still walking and sees round corner (girl 2) and a boy having a fight/argument (Boy 1) says to (boy 2) “Keep this between us” (Girl 2) says to boy “I hate you, just get out of my life!” (Girl 1) looks away and continues to walk down the street One man gets jumped by another man and they fight and come across the path of (Girl 1) so she has to step back. There is an exchange of dialogue between the men: “You thought you could get away did you?” (Girl 1) gasps and continues walking down the street looking worried and afraid (Girl 1) walks to the end of road into a woodland and stops as she realises she is lost A hand comes from behind over her mouth before the screen goes black. There is then a shot of (Girl 1)’s feet elevated off the ground like she has be hanged. The screen fades black once more and the ‘Hanging Hill Lane’ title comes on the screen. Screen fades from black to tracking shot of girl 1’s footsteps then a head-on medium shot of girl that reveals vulnerability and facial expression. Non diegetic ST on. Low angle medium shot of the two boys with a close up of their hands and the package. Low key lighting. Over the shoulder shot off girl 1 walking. Camera pans round corner (from girl 1’s POV) to see the argument side on. Camera comes back to close up shot of girls facial expression as she looks away and keeps walking. From Girl 1’s POV she sees the two men come out from the side and then there is a side on eye level shot as she steps back and gasps. Camera continues to track Girl 1’s walking down the street. There is a high angle close up shot as she looks up at the woodland ahead. The camera is then positioned behind at a high angle as she starts to walk into the woodland. The lighting changes from high key to low key. High angle shot of Girl 1 stood in forest as if lost. Cuts to eye line match of girl 1’s face as the hand comes over. Then a low angle low key lighting shot from behind as you see the girls feet.

Additional Notes (for group purpose):• The events that unfold while the girl walks

down the lane are in slow motion with the dialogue being added in over the top with some kind of sound effect like an echo for dramatic effect. This is because the soundtrack will make up most of the sound and the dialogue should be quick and punchy.

• The idea is that it should be as if the girl isn’t actually there and the events are just unfolding in font of her.

• All of the clips of the events that happen should be fairly fast paced while the shots of the girl walking should start off slow and get quicker as the soundtrack builds up.
